ON ARCHITECTURE:
SCALE OF DESIGN FROM MICRO TO MACRO
Fourth International Conference and Exhibition
We are experiencing an unprecedented era in the history of urbanization. Some of the defining challenges of the 21st century are managing the pace of urban growth, creating new approaches in architecture, increasing the quality of living spaces, as well as controlling the environmental quality. At the same time, they also present an opportunity to create living spaces that are smarter, more efficient, more sustainable, and more equal and safer. Design in the scale from micro to macro is the key for improvement and quality of urban and living space.
Themes of the Conference are promoting quality design in the micro – macro scale which improves the life of citizens, and also visitors, with attractive place for living.
Creation of quality design is important for individual living of habitants in the micro scale of significance – furniture, house – interior, exterior, environment, but as well as for the design in a wider macro scale which emphasizes the advantages of a city and potentials for more attractive business, qualified manpower, attraction of students, tourist potential, and events of wider significance. Biography
Ružica Bogdanović, Phd is a Professor of Urban planning and Sustainable development. Main areas of interest in research and teaching include: Architecture & Urban Design, New MediaApproach to Architecture, Concept of Smart City.
She has initiated, conducted and implemented a number of scientific research projects as team leader and principal investigator. Has organized and moderated numerous panel discussions, round tables, national and international Symposia. Author of numerous books and articles in professional journals. Presented papers at numerous national and international Conferences and Symposia.
Ružica Bogdanović contributes to the profession by active engagement in different professional organizations. She is a member of IsoCaRp, a delegate of Serbia in the ECTP, member of the Association of Serbian Town Planners, Society of Belgrade Urban Planners (was a Chairperson for 8 years in two terms), Belgrade Association of Architects.
She received several awards for projects and books, as well as the Lifetime Achievement Award “Emilijan Josimovic Grand Award”.
